First-order intertwining operators with position dependent mass and $η$- weak-psuedo-Hermiticity generators

arXiv:quant-ph/0607030 · doi:10.1007/s10773-007-9470-7

Abstract

A Hermitian and an anti-Hermitian first-order intertwining operators are introduced and a class of $η$-weak-pseudo-Hermitian position-dependent mass (PDM) Hamiltonians are constructed. A corresponding reference-target $η$-weak-pseudo-Hermitian PDM -- Hamiltonians' map is suggested. Some $η$-weak-pseudo-Hermitian PT -symmetric Scarf II and periodic-type models are used as illustrative examples. Energy-levels crossing and flown-away states phenomena are reported for the resulting Scarf II spectrum. Some of the corresponding $η$-weak-pseudo-Hermitian Scarf II- and periodic-type-isospectral models (PT -symmetric and non-PT -symmetric) are given as products of the reference-target map.
